These are really good, Tripis. :thumbup: You keep getting better and better every day! How did you take these, I want to try that out :P

 

Thanks a lot! These were taken in my light box. I used string to strap a cooking baster (like this one: http://www.dkimages.com/discover/previe ... 102074.JPG ) to the top of the light box, and let it hang vertically. I placed a large box on the ground, put coloured paper on top of the box and on the back of the light box (the paper colour was chosen based on what colour I wanted the picture to be). Then I placed a dish, filled with water, on top of the box/paper. I put it on top of a box to get it up off the ground a bit, so I could get a better angle. I tied a paper clip to a string and tied it to the top of the light box so it hung down in line with the cooking baster. I used this paper clip to help focus my camera, which was mounted on a tripod. I then filled the cooking baster with water, which allowed it to continuously drip. I then took the pictures with a remote to avoid camera shake..

 

 

 

However, I am thinking of replacing the cooking baster with a bag filled with water, with a small hole at the bottom. The bag would hold a lot more water than a cooking baster, so I wouldn't have to keep stopping to refill it.
